The women's heptathlon at the 2017 World Championships in Athletics will be held at the Olympic Stadium on 5 and 6 August.

Records

Prior to the competition, the records were as follows:[1]

World record  Jackie Joyner-Kersee (USA) 7291 Seoul, South Korea 24 September 1988
Championship record  Jackie Joyner-Kersee (USA) 7128 Rome, Italy 1 September 1987
World leading  Nafissatou Thiam (BEL) 7013 Götzis, Austria 28 May 2017
African record  Margaret Simpson (GHA) 6423 Götzis, Austria 29 May 2005
Asian record  Ghada Shouaa (SYR) 6942 Götzis, Austria 26 May 1996
North, Central American and Caribbean record  Jackie Joyner-Kersee (USA) 7291 Seoul, South Korea 24 September 1988
South American record  Evelis Aguilar (COL) 6270 Cali, Colombia 26 June 2016
European record  Carolina Klüft (SWE) 7032 Osaka, Japan 26 August 2007
Oceanian record  Jane Flemming (AUS) 6695 Auckland, New Zealand 28 January 1990

Schedule

Date Time Round
5 August 2017 10:05 100 metres hurdles
5 August 2017 11:30 High jump
5 August 2017 19:00 Shot put
5 August 2017 21:00 200 metres
6 August 2017 10:00 Long jump
6 August 2017 11:45 Javelin throw
6 August 2017 20:40 800 metres

All times are local times (UTC+1)
